package org.hawkular.bus.broker.extension;
import java.io.File;
import java.util.Map;
import org.hawkular.bus.broker.extension.log.MsgLogger;
import org.jboss.as.server.ServerEnvironment;
import org.jboss.logging.Logger;
import org.jboss.modules.Module;
import org.jboss.modules.Resource;
import org.jboss.util.StringPropertyReplacer;
public class BrokerConfigurationSetup {
private final MsgLogger msglog = MsgLogger.LOGGER;
private final Logger log = Logger.getLogger(BrokerConfigurationSetup.class);
/**
* The location of the configuration file. This will be a usable path for the broker to use.
*/
private final String configurationFile;
/**
* Properties that will be used to complete the out-of-box configuration.
*/
private final Map customConfiguration;
/**
* Provides environment information about the server in which we are embedded.
*/
private final ServerEnvironment serverEnvironment;
public BrokerConfigurationSetup(String configFile, Map customConfigProps,
ServerEnvironment serverEnv) {
if (configFile == null || configFile.trim().isEmpty()) {
configFile = BrokerSubsystemExtension.BROKER_CONFIG_FILE_DEFAULT;
}
this.customConfiguration = customConfigProps;
this.serverEnvironment = serverEnv;
this.configurationFile = getUsableConfigurationFilePath(configFile, serverEnv);
prepareConfiguration();
}
public String getConfigurationFile() {
return configurationFile;
}
public Map getCustomConfiguration() {
return customConfiguration;
}
public ServerEnvironment getServerEnvironment() {
return serverEnvironment;
}
private void prepareConfiguration() {
// perform some checking to setup defaults if need be
Map customConfigProps = this.customConfiguration;
prepareConfigurationProperty(customConfigProps, BrokerSubsystemExtension.BROKER_NAME_SYSPROP, //
BrokerSubsystemExtension.BROKER_NAME_DEFAULT);
prepareConfigurationProperty(customConfigProps, BrokerSubsystemExtension.BROKER_PERSISTENT_SYSPROP, //
Boolean.toString(BrokerSubsystemExtension.PERSISTENT_DEFAULT));
prepareConfigurationProperty(customConfigProps, BrokerSubsystemExtension.BROKER_USE_JMX_SYSPROP, //
Boolean.toString(BrokerSubsystemExtension.USE_JMX_DEFAULT));
prepareConfigurationProperty(customConfigProps, BrokerSubsystemExtension.BROKER_CONNECTOR_NAME_SYSPROP, //
BrokerSubsystemExtension.CONNECTOR_NAME_DEFAULT);
prepareConfigurationProperty(customConfigProps, BrokerSubsystemExtension.BROKER_CONNECTOR_PROTOCOL_SYSPROP, //
BrokerSubsystemExtension.CONNECTOR_PROTOCOL_DEFAULT);
// replace ${x} tokens in all values
for (Map.Entry entry : customConfigProps.entrySet()) {
String value = entry.getValue();
if (value != null) {
entry.setValue(StringPropertyReplacer.replaceProperties(value));
}
}
return;
}
private void prepareConfigurationProperty(Map customConfigProps, String prop, String defaultValue) {
String propValue = customConfigProps.get(prop);
if (propValue == null || propValue.trim().length() == 0 || "-".equals(propValue)) {
log.debugf("Broker configuration property [%s] was undefined; will default to [%s]", prop, defaultValue);
customConfigProps.put(prop, defaultValue);
}
return;
}
/**
* Because the EmbeddedBroker uses third party libs to read the config file, it needs to have been put it in a place
* where we can know and pass along its absolute path. This returns that absolute path of the config file.
*
* @param configFile the absolute or relative path that will be converted to absolute path the broker can use
* @param serverEnv the server environment we can use to look for the file
*
* @return the absolute path of the config file that the broker will use
*/
private String getUsableConfigurationFilePath(String configFile, ServerEnvironment serverEnv) {
File file = new File(configFile);
// if it is already absolute, use it as-is
if (file.isAbsolute()) {
return file.getAbsolutePath();
}
// see if there is one in the server configuration directory; if so, use it.
File serverConfigDir = serverEnv.getServerConfigurationDir();
File configFileInServerConfigDir = new File(serverConfigDir, configFile);
if (configFileInServerConfigDir.exists()) {
return configFileInServerConfigDir.getAbsolutePath();
}
// we still can't find the config file - see if its in the module's exported config/ directory
try {
Module module = Module.forClass(getClass());
Resource r = module.getExportedResource("config", configFile);
return r.getURL().toString();
} catch (Throwable t) {
// oh well, we tried - return the configFile as-is - we'll probably fail later because its probably missing
msglog.warnCannotDetermineConfigFilePath(configFile, t.toString());
return configFile;
}
}
}
